Alexis became an ally of the Kuuma, Cervano quit the Zaido Squad, and Gallian was painted as a bad leader. What happened to the Zaidos?
Alexis tried to return to the Galactic Force even after discovering he was Drigo's son. But when his hesitation led to Lyvia’s death, Alexis decided to move away from the organization. Seeking solace in Mona’s arms, Alexis realized too late how much she meant to him; she already stopped waiting for him to notice her. Meanwhile, his discovery that Amy and Cervano were now an item pushed him over the edge, making him turn his back on everything he believed was right. Cervano and Amy too, became disillusioned as they realized Gallian was only his mother's puppet. With Carmela’s and Lyvia’s death, the two decided to leave the Galactic Force and to take Captain Zion with them—an act that widened their rift with Gallian, who still believed that the Galactic Force was the best judge of what is right and wrong. Meanwhile, unbeknown to everyone except Gallian, Carmela is alive and well—and far away from Earth and the Galactic Force. A new evil will reign on Earth and the Universe as Alexis embraces his dark side as Sigma: the leader of Le-Ar’s army of reborn monsters. Can Gallian save the town of Tala all by himself?
